Understanding the Bedrock of Classic Slot Machines
Originally rooted in physical machines found in arcades and casino floors, classic slots were characterized by three-reel setups, straightforward gameplay, and symbolic imagery such as fruits, bars, and sevens. Their simplicity was key to their popularity—easy to understand yet offering the thrill of chance.
Industry analysts note that during the peak of land-based casinos in the 1980s and 1990s, the majority of players preferred these straightforward machines over complex video slots. According to the Gaming Standards Association, classic slots accounted for over 60% of slot revenue during that period, underscoring their dominance in the gambling landscape.
The Digital Revolution: Maintaining Tradition with Innovation
With the advent of online gambling in the late 1990s, the challenge was to adapt the familiar mechanics of classic slots for the virtual environment without diluting their core appeal. Developers focused on recreating the simplicity and nostalgic charm while integrating features like higher payout percentages, progressive jackpots, and immersive themes.
| Aspect | Physical Slot Machines | Online Digital Slots |
|---|---|---|
| Design | Mechanical reels with physical symbols | Graphically rendered reels with animated symbols |
| Gameplay | Single-line bets, straightforward rules | Multiple pay lines, bonus rounds, adaptive themes |
| Player Experience | Physical presence, tactile feedback | Interactive, accessible on various devices |
Many of today’s leading online slots are inspired by the traditional three-reel format, appealing to nostalgic players while attracting a new generation seeking convenience with a touch of vintage charm.
